

PRETTY IN PINK
Book • 1986
In 'Pretty in Pink', Andie Walsh, a smart and stylish girl from a poor background, navigates the complex social landscape of her affluent high school.
The novel explores themes of social class, personal identity, and authentic relationships as Andie finds herself drawn to Blane McDonough, a member of the wealthy elite.
The book is based on the original screenplay by John Hughes and includes the original ending, which differs from the film.
